The restaurant Il Pollaio, an authentic Italian restaurant in the vibrant North Beach neighborhood of San Francisco, invites you to a delightful culinary journey. You’ll discover a casual atmosphere perfect for enjoying a quick bite or a leisurely meal.
Whether you’re craving a robust dinner or a light lunch, this spot offers a welcoming experience for everyone.
Il Pollaio offers a distinctly casual and cozy dining experience, often described as feeling like a home kitchen. Many appreciate the friendly service and comfortable atmosphere, though some note the decor could use an update.
It’s a place where the focus is clearly on the food and the welcome. The culinary offerings, particularly the grilled chicken, generally receive high marks for being fresh and satisfying.
However, a few diners have encountered issues with food quality, mentioning instances of dry chicken or burnt food. Despite this, the overall sentiment leans towards a positive and practical dining choice.

Il Pollaio earns a solid 8.2 overall, reflecting a generally positive dining experience. This is further supported by a strong 84.3% customer satisfaction rate, indicating that most patrons leave content.
With 305 positive remarks against just 38 negative ones out of 362 total comments, the feedback leans heavily towards approval. Diving into the specifics, Service leads the way with an impressive (8.5), often praised for its friendliness.
The Ambience also scores well (8.3), contributing to a comfortable setting. Food, a central focus, maintains a good standing (8.2), while Value (7.1) is considered fair, especially given the generous portions.
With a strong recommendation score of 8.3, Il Pollaio generally delivers a satisfying experience. It’s a solid choice if you’re seeking a casual, comfortable spot with reliably good grilled dishes and friendly service, especially if you appreciate a home-like atmosphere.
However, be mindful of potential inconsistencies in food preparation and the somewhat dated decor. If you prioritize a no-frills, value-driven meal over a polished setting, this spot is certainly worth considering for its core strengths.
